Warning: file_get_contents(/data/phpspider/zhask/data//catemap/8/mysql/70.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
从远程主机连接到mysql数据库_Mysql_Mariadb_Connect - Fatal编程技术网

从远程主机连接到mysql数据库

从远程主机连接到mysql数据库,mysql,mariadb,connect,Mysql,Mariadb,Connect,我有点困惑,围绕此主题的所有文档和指南都显示以下命令: mysql --host=remote_server --user=myname --password=password mydb 这是否意味着我也必须在远程主机上安装mysql?(我从中连接) 问题是,我在一台服务器上的docker上运行Wordpress&NGINX,在另一台服务器上运行MariaDB,所以我只想测试连接 我有什么误解吗?您需要的只是MySQL客户端。服务器应用程序是运行SQL的部分,客户端是允许您键入命令和运行SQL

我有点困惑,围绕此主题的所有文档和指南都显示以下命令:

mysql --host=remote_server --user=myname --password=password mydb
这是否意味着我也必须在远程主机上安装mysql?(我从中连接)

问题是,我在一台服务器上的docker上运行Wordpress&NGINX,在另一台服务器上运行MariaDB,所以我只想测试连接

我有什么误解吗?

您需要的只是MySQL客户端。服务器应用程序是运行SQL的部分,客户端是允许您键入命令和运行SQL的部分

您显示的命令是连接到远程服务器,因此您需要在要访问它的计算机上使用客户端软件。这是WordPress系统的docker主机,还是台式机,你的问题还不清楚

通过其他应用程序连接的客户端不需要客户端或服务器应用程序,只需要库/驱动程序。有多个可用的,但当您运行WordPress时,PHP内置了连接性